Products: approve

Aprova o produto especificado e as permissões relevantes do app, se houver. O número máximo de produtos que podem ser aprovados por cliente corporativo é 1.000.

Para saber como usar o Google Play gerenciado ao criar e criar um layout de loja para exibir produtos aprovados aos usuários, consulte Design de layout da loja.

Observação: este item foi descontinuado. Novas integrações não podem usar esse método e podem consultar nossas novas recomendações.

Solicitação

Solicitação HTTP

POST https://www.googleapis.com/androidenterprise/v1/enterprises/enterpriseId/products/productId/approve

Parâmetros

Nome do parâmetro Valor Descrição
Parâmetros de caminho
enterpriseId string O ID da empresa.
productId string ID do produto.

Autorização

Esta solicitação requer autorização com o seguinte escopo:

Escopo
https://www.googleapis.com/auth/androidenterprise

Para mais informações, consulte a página de autenticação e autorização.

Corpo da solicitação

No corpo da solicitação, forneça os dados com a seguinte estrutura:

{
  "approvalUrlInfo": {
    "kind": "androidenterprise#approvalUrlInfo",
    "approvalUrl": string
  },
  "approvedPermissions": string
}
Nome da propriedade Valor Descrição Observações
approvalUrlInfo nested object O URL de aprovação que foi exibido para o usuário. Somente as permissões do usuário com esse URL serão aceitas, o que pode não constituir um conjunto completo de permissões do produto. Por exemplo, o URL só poderá exibir novas permissões depois de o produto ser aprovado ou não incluir novas permissões se o produto tiver sido atualizado desde que o URL foi gerado.
approvalUrlInfo.approvalUrl string Um URL que exibe as permissões de um produto e que também pode ser usado para aprovar o produto com a chamada Products.approve.
approvedPermissions string Define como novas solicitações de permissão para o produto são processadas. "allPermissions" aprova automaticamente todas as permissões atuais e futuras para o produto. "currentPermissionsOnly" aprova o conjunto atual de permissões do produto, mas as futuras permissões adicionadas por meio de atualizações exigirão a reaprovação manual. Se não for especificado, somente o conjunto atual de permissões será aprovado.

Os valores aceitáveis são:
  • "allPermissions"
  • "currentPermissionsOnly"
approvalUrlInfo.kind string

Resposta

Se bem-sucedido, este método retornará um corpo de resposta vazio.